At 8:42, Maria will have been jogging for 42 minutes. The distance she will have travelled is:
42 / 60 * 4 miles = 2.8 miles
Nicole starts 12 minutes later, so she starts at 8:12. At 8:42 she will have been jogging for 30 minutes.
During this time she needs to cover 2.8 miles to catch up with Maria.
So, if R is her rate per hour:
30 / 60 * R = 2.8
0.5R = 2.8
R = 5.6 mph
